Career Role Description
International ELL Social Studies Teacher (Primary & Secondary) Educates diverse student populations in social studies, adapting curriculum to varying English language proficiency levels. High demand in multicultural UK settings.
ESL Social Studies Specialist (Secondary Education) Focuses on developing social studies content knowledge alongside English language acquisition. Significant expertise in differentiated instruction is crucial.
International Baccalaureate (IB) Social Studies Teacher (Secondary) Teaches IB social studies programs to international students, emphasizing global perspectives and critical thinking skills. Requires deep understanding of IB curricula.
Curriculum Developer (Social Studies, ELL) Creates and adapts social studies curricula for international ELL students. Collaborates with teachers and educational leaders for effective implementation.

A Professional Certificate in Teaching Social Studies to International ELLs is increasingly significant in today's UK education market. The growing diversity of the UK school population necessitates specialized teacher training. According to the Office for National Statistics, the proportion of children from minority ethnic backgrounds in state-funded schools in England increased to 34.6% in 2021. This trend highlights a critical need for educators equipped to effectively teach Social Studies to English Language Learners (ELLs) from diverse linguistic and cultural backgrounds.

This certificate equips teachers with the pedagogical skills and subject knowledge to meet this demand. It addresses the specific challenges of teaching social studies concepts to ELLs, including adapting curriculum, utilizing effective communication strategies, and fostering inclusive classrooms. The program prepares professionals to navigate the diverse needs of students with varying English proficiency levels, ensuring equitable access to high-quality education. Successful completion demonstrates commitment to inclusive practices and a deep understanding of culturally responsive teaching, highly valued by UK schools and institutions.

Year % of Pupils from Minority Ethnic Backgrounds
2020 33%
2021 34.6%
